Mold Removal Safety Precautions If you have to remove mold concentrations or perform any black mold removal covering more than a few square feet, we recommend you take these precautions: Wear old clothes and shoes that you can launder or throw away after the cleanup work Wear special N-95 or P-100 respirators in addition to goggles and gloves

Mold Cleanup Who should do the cleanup depends on a number of factors One consideration is the size of the mold problem If the moldy area is less than about 10 square feet (less than roughly a 3 ft by 3 ft patch), in most cases, you can handle the job yourself, follow the Mold Cleanup Tips and Techniques However:

What to wear Take steps to protect your mouth, nose, skin, and eyes when cleaning up mold Protect your mouth and nose against breathing in mold: wear at least a NIOSH Approved N95 respirator If you plan to spend a lot of time removing moldy belongings or doing work like ripping out moldy drywall, wear a half-face or full-face respirator
